Vineyard-covered valleys, acclaimed restaurants and some of South Africa's most beautiful landscapes have helped establish the Cape Winelands as one of the country's most rewarding destinations.
The Cape Winelands combine spectacular scenery, world-class hospitality and a rich winemaking heritage, creating one of South Africa's most elegant and rewarding regions. Set amongst rolling mountains and fertile valleys just beyond Cape Town, the area is home to some of the country's most celebrated wine estates, historic towns and luxury retreats.
Franschhoek, Stellenbosch and Paarl each bring their own character to the region, from Cape Dutch architecture and centuries-old estates to acclaimed restaurants and boutique wineries. Vineyards stretch across the landscape, framed by dramatic mountain scenery that changes colour and character throughout the year.
Yet the appeal of the Winelands extends far beyond wine alone. Exceptional food, beautiful gardens, scenic drives and a slower pace of life encourage visitors to linger longer than planned. Luxury country estates, boutique hotels and vineyard retreats provide memorable places to stay in a destination that combines natural beauty, hospitality and some of the finest food and wine experiences in Africa.

Cleopatra Mountain Farmhouse, a charming country-chic retreat in KwaZulu-Natal's Drakensberg Mountains, offers serene luxury beside a tranquil dam. Its idyllic setting borders the Giants Castle Nature Reserve, framed by majestic mountain vistas. The thoughtfully designed accommodations, encompassing rooms, suites, and cottages, exude rustic elegance with countryside-inspired decor, each featuring plush linens and inviting fireplaces for ultimate comfort. Guests can unwind in free-standing bathtubs, soaking in the peaceful ambiance, or relax by a roaring fire, enveloped by the serene beauty of the surrounding landscape. Dining is a highlight, with a delectable three-course breakfast to start the day, followed by homemade cakes and pastries served in the afternoon. The evening brings an exquisite six-course dinner, showcasing award-winning cuisine crafted with passion and fresh ingredients, offering a memorable culinary journey. The warm hospitality of the hosts ensures a bespoke experience, with thoughtful touches enhancing every moment. Adventurous guests can explore the region's natural wonders, with hosts arranging excursions to view ancient Bushman paintings, hikes through pristine trails, or cycling adventures with rental bikes. Trout fishing and refreshing swims in mountain streams offer further connection to the breathtaking surroundings. Located 9 km from the Ukahlamba Drakensberg World Heritage Site and 49.9 km from Mooi River, Cleopatra Mountain Farmhouse delivers an enchanting blend of refined comfort and wilderness allure.

Majeka House, an owner-managed boutique retreat in Stellenbosch, offers a stylish haven amidst lush gardens. Perfectly positioned, it invites exploration of the historic town's vibrant shops, galleries, and renowned Winelands. The 22 exquisitely designed rooms, transformed by interior designer Etienne Hanekom in 2011, feature bold colours, rich textures, and custom wallpapers, blending drama with serene comfort. Two luxury mountain suites boast expansive balconies with breathtaking mountain views, while three junior garden suites overlook a shared, exclusive-use pool. Each room includes air-conditioning, satellite televisions, Lavazza espresso machines, DVD players with a movie selection, and en-suite bathrooms fragrant with local toiletries crafted from indigenous plant extracts, complemented by thoughtful touches like comfy Crocs. Makaron Restaurant, with its award-winning contemporary interiors of repurposed furniture and modern statement pieces, serves fresh, modern cuisine grounded in French classics by chef Tanja Kruger, using ingredients from the onsite organic garden. Guests can dine in the airy restaurant, on the sheltered terrace overlooking lush gardens, or by a cosy fireplace in winter, paired with fine Cape wines. The sophisticated bar enhances the elegant dining experience with its witty ambiance. The professionally run Majeka Spa offers a range of massages, facials, and treatments, alongside a sauna, steam room, and fitness centre, while the communal indoor pool and semi-exclusive outdoor pools provide tranquil relaxation. Less than a 10-minute drive from Stellenbosch's city centre and 3 km from Stellenbosch Golf Club, Majeka House delivers a seamless blend of luxurious sophistication and the Cape Winelands' timeless charm.

Batavia Boutique Hotel, an award-winning gem in Stellenbosch's historic heart, offers luxurious comfort and intimate hospitality. Steps from Dorp Street, it's perfect for exploring the vibrant village on foot. The classical 19th-century guesthouse, honoured as Best Boutique Hotel from 2005 to 2007 and inducted into the Hall of Fame in 2008 and 2009 by the AA Accommodation Awards, features elegantly spacious rooms blending antique charm with contemporary finesse. Each air-conditioned room is adorned with beautiful sofas, oversized chairs, refined tables, and flat-screen satellite televisions, creating a sophisticated yet welcoming retreat. Guests are treated to a sumptuous breakfast in the elegant dining room, with late afternoon tea, cakes, and drinks served in-room or on the charming patio beside the sparkling outdoor swimming pool. The hotel's tailored service ensures a bespoke experience, whether relaxing by the pool or strolling to nearby landmarks like the Stellenbosch Museum and Moederkerk, both within easy walking distance. The surrounding Stellenbosch wine route, South Africa's oldest and most celebrated, invites guests to indulge in world-class wine tasting, while activities such as hot air balloon trips, helicopter rides, fishing, and mountain biking offer adventure and exploration. Located just 24 km from Cape Town International Airport, Batavia Boutique Hotel provides complimentary private parking, ensuring a seamless and luxurious escape in the heart of Stellenbosch.

Grande Roche Hotel, a luxurious five-star retreat at the foot of Paarl Rock, evokes the gracious charm of a bygone era. This celebrated historical monument offers an elegant base for exploring the Cape Winelands. Set amidst beautiful gardens with captivating views of vineyards and mountains, the hotel's air-conditioned rooms feature flat-screen satellite televisions, fridges, kettles, hairdryers, wardrobes, and private bathrooms with complimentary toiletries, ensuring refined comfort. The Manor House, steeped in history, exudes timeless sophistication, blending period elegance with modern amenities for a serene and unhurried stay. The innovative cuisine at the Manor House restaurant showcases fresh, local ingredients, with continental and buffet breakfast options served daily, complemented by a curated selection of Cape wines available at the stylish bar. Guests can unwind by the sparkling outdoor pools, relax on the sun terrace, or enjoy attentive 24-hour front desk service, room service, and seamless airport transfers, enhancing the bespoke hospitality. The surrounding area invites exploration with activities like hiking, cycling, or golfing on nearby internationally acclaimed courses, with bike and car hire available for convenience. Located 7 km from Fairview Winery & Cheese and 8 km from Nederburg Wines, with Cape Town International Airport 48 km away, Grande Roche Hotel delivers a harmonious blend of historic allure and contemporary luxury in the heart of the Winelands.

The Robertson Small Hotel, Robertson's only five-star retreat, offers superlative service amidst lush gardens and two serene pool areas. Built in 1909 as a National Monument, it exudes timeless elegance in the heart of the Cape Winelands. The ten distinct rooms, including three Victorian-style Manor House suites with high embossed ceilings and large veranda-facing windows, feature elegant modern furnishings, flat-screen satellite televisions, DVD players, and private bathrooms with bathrobes and slippers. Collaborations with designers like Studio Ashby and Alexis Barrell create a sophisticated ambiance, with some suites offering spacious seating areas for refined relaxation. The Small Restaurant serves exquisite seasonal dishes crafted from local produce, paired with choice valley wines, available for breakfast, lunch, and dinner by appointment, except for hotel guests' breakfast. Dining is offered in the historic Manor House or on the scenic patio overlooking verdant gardens, complemented by a stylish bar. Each guest receives The Small Guide, a beautifully curated exploration of Robertson's treasures. Guests can enjoy a wellness room for rejuvenation, relax by the pools, or explore nearby golf courses and hiking trails. Located 700 metres from Robertson Mall, 900 metres from House of Golden Kaan and Robertson Art Gallery, The Robertson Small Hotel, with complimentary parking, delivers an intimate fusion of historic charm and luxurious indulgence.

Le Quartier Français, a romantic 25-room auberge in the heart of Franschhoek, offers an enchanting retreat steeped in charm. Its prime location makes it an ideal base for exploring the Cape Winelands' scenic beauty. The 25 elegantly appointed rooms, blending vibrant hues with classic sophistication, feature air-conditioning, flat-screen televisions, and luxurious private bathrooms, with select suites boasting private pools for added indulgence. Each space is meticulously designed with exceptional attention to detail, ensuring a refined and comfortable stay that reflects the auberge's commitment to personalised hospitality. A complimentary breakfast is served daily at Protégé, just 140 metres away, showcasing fresh, local flavours in a refined setting. The hotel's extraordinary staff enhance the experience with services like bicycle rentals for exploring Franschhoek's quaint village, filled with boutique shops, galleries, and award-winning restaurants, all within a short walk. Guests can relax by the inviting outdoor pool or venture to nearby attractions, including the Huguenot Memorial Monument and renowned wine estates. With complimentary private parking and a shuttle service available to Cape Town, 60 km away, Le Quartier Français seamlessly blends romantic elegance with the vibrant allure of the Franschhoek Valley.
